What is a Machine Shop Helper job?

A Machine Shop Helper supports machinists and other workers by performing tasks such as material handling, cleaning equipment, and assisting with basic machine operations. They help keep the shop organized, maintain tools, and ensure a safe work environment. This role requires attention to detail, the ability to follow instructions, and basic mechanical skills. It is an entry-level position that provides hands-on experience in a manufacturing setting.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Machine Shop Helper position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Machine Shop Helper, you need a solid understanding of basic mechanical skills, familiarity with hand and power tools, and often a high school diploma or equivalent. Experience with measurement instruments like calipers and micrometers, and knowledge of safety protocols such as OSHA standards, are commonly required. Strong attention to detail, reliability, and good communication skills help you stand out in this supportive role. These abilities are crucial for maintaining safety, supporting machinists effectively, and ensuring the smooth operation of shop activities.

What are typical daily responsibilities for a Machine Shop Helper?

Machine Shop Helpers typically assist machinists by preparing materials, maintaining a clean and organized work area, and transporting parts or tools as needed. Their day often includes using basic hand tools, operating cleaning equipment, performing routine maintenance on machinery, and ensuring all work areas comply with safety standards. Helpers may also be responsible for setting up or breaking down equipment, helping with inventory, and supporting quality control checks. Working closely with machinists and other shop staff provides valuable hands-on experience and opportunities to learn about advanced machine operations.

Job Description

The Shop Helper supports daily manufacturing operations by assisting with inspections, basic quality checks, and general shop tasks. This role works closely with machine operators and other team members, gradually learning basic machine operation while helping keep the shop organized, efficient, and running smoothly.

Responsibilities

  • Assist with inspections and perform basic quality checks on products and materials.
  • Support machine operators with setup, operation, and general production tasks as needed.
  • Learn and perform basic machine operation over time under guidance and training.
  • Provide general shop support in any area that needs help, including shipping, packing, basic operating, and material handling.
  • Perform general production tasks such as assembly, grinding, deburring, fabrication, packaging, and packing.
  • Handle materials safely, including loading, unloading, and moving items around the shop.
  • Operate forklifts and other equipment as required, once properly trained and authorized.
  • Use a tape measure and basic hand tools accurately to support fabrication and production work.
  • Maintain a neat, clean, and organized work area at all times.
  • Collaborate and communicate effectively with the Shop Foreman, management, and other staff to support smooth workflow.
  • Follow safety procedures and guidelines while working around machinery and manufacturing equipment.
  • Stand, walk, lift, and operate equipment for extended periods to meet production needs.
